Functions not referenced outside of a source file should be marked
static to prevent them from being exposed globally.
Quiets the sparse warnings:
warning: symbol 'ca91cx42_alloc_consistent' was not declared. Should it be static?
warning: symbol 'ca91cx42_free_consistent' was not declared. Should it be static?
